Cost of Living Comparison Between Sousse and Tunis Cost of Living Comparison Between Sousse and Tunis

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$710 per month in Sousse vs $740 in Tunis, rent included.

A couple spends around $1,145 per month in Sousse vs $1,175 in Tunis, rent included.

A family of three spends $1,580 per month in Sousse vs $1,609 in Tunis, rent included.

Sousse is about 4% cheaper than Tunis,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.

Both Sousse and Tunis are more affordable than the global median – Sousse 47% lower, Tunis 45%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$244 in Sousse versus $276 in Tunis.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 6% higher in Sousse,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$24.00 in Sousse versus $26.00 in Tunis.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$185 vs $201 – making Sousse the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
